Common Myths Concerning Alcohol Rehab



When it involves alcohol rehab, many individuals hold misunderstandings that can stop them from looking for help.

One usual misconception is that rehabilitation is a one-size-fits-all remedy. In reality, treatment must be individualized to fit your distinct needs.

One more mistaken belief is that rehabilitation is only for those with severe dependency, but also modest alcohol consumption can bring about severe consequences.

You might likewise assume that rehab is just regarding detox, while it actually involves therapy and support for lasting recovery.

The Reality Behind Treatment Strategies



Although lots of people consider alcohol rehab as a single pathway to recovery, treatment approaches in fact differ extensively based upon specific requirements and situations.

Each approach has its own benefits and might suit various lifestyles or levels of dependency.

For example, if you need a structured setting, inpatient rehabilitation could be excellent. On the other hand, if you have responsibilities in your home or job, outpatient therapy could be a better fit.

In addition, therapy designs can differ, ranging from cognitive behavioral therapy to all natural approaches.

Recognizing the Recuperation Refine



Selecting the best treatment method is just the start of your journey towards recuperation. Comprehending the recovery procedure is crucial for your success.



It's not a direct course; you'll experience ups and downs along the road. Originally, you'll likely deal with withdrawal signs, yet this phase is momentary.

As you proceed, you'll work with recognizing triggers and creating coping methods. This typically entails treatment, support groups, and developing a strong support system.
